Le Clos des Noyers is a charming residence located in the heart of Combronde, a small town in the Auvergne region. This nineteenth-century mansion showcases the region's iconic Volvic stonework and has maintained its original period decor. With its high molded ceilings, marble fireplaces, and exquisite oak paneling in the reception rooms, the mansion exudes a timeless elegance.As you enter the grand entrance hall, you will be greeted by a stunning trompe l'oeil painted ceiling and silkscreened glass panes. The lounge, equipped with a TV and library, is the perfect place to unwind and relax. Enjoy a delicious breakfast in the dining room, the spacious kitchen, or on the sunny south terrace.
Ascending the magnificent Volvic stone staircase, you will find the guest rooms on the upper floor. Choose from three tastefully decorated double bedrooms or opt for the spacious "The Combrailles" suite. These rooms offer a peaceful and comfortable retreat, inspired by the picturesque Auvergne countryside.
Surrounded by walls, the property maintains a sense of privacy and intimacy. At the front of the house, a spacious south-facing terrace invites you to soak up the sun, while a charming French garden provides a serene escape. Behind the mansion lies a medieval-style garden adorned with colorful flowers and a square of fragrant herbs. Further on, you will discover a sprawling park filled with majestic trees such as cedar, pine, chestnut, redwood, and charm, along with an orchard boasting apple, pear, cherry, and grape trees.

Address: 12 rue du General Desaix, 63460 COMBRONDE
GPS coordinates: Latitude 45.980032 - Longitude 3.087353
Le Clos Walnut is located in the center of Combronde, a small town. It is only a 5-minute drive from the A71-A89 highway interchange.
We are conveniently situated 10 minutes away from Riom and 20 minutes away from Clermont-Ferrand.
The nearest train station is Riom - Châtel Guyon, and the closest airport is Clermont-Ferrand Auvergne Airport.
If you enjoy walking, the GR300 trail runs alongside our property.
Parking is available in our courtyard, which is secure with a gate (you will be provided with a badge). Additionally, we have a barn where you can safely park your bikes.

- Château de Chazeron: Located in Loubeyrat, just a short drive from Combronde, Château de Chazeron is a medieval fortress with a fascinating history. Explore its towers, dungeons, and beautiful gardens while learning about its role in the region's past.
- Vulcania: Situated in Saint-Ours-les-Roches, Vulcania is a popular theme park dedicated to volcanoes and geology. Discover interactive exhibits, 3D movies, and thrilling attractions that provide insight into the fascinating world of volcanoes.
- Château de Tournoël: Offering panoramic views of the surrounding countryside, Château de Tournoël is a medieval castle located in Volvic. Take a guided tour of the well-preserved ruins, learn about its strategic importance, and enjoy the stunning vistas from its hilltop location.
- Clermont-Ferrand Cathedral: Situated in the heart of Clermont-Ferrand, the city's cathedral is a magnificent example of Gothic architecture. Admire its intricate stained glass windows, towering spires, and impressive interior, including the black volcanic stone used in its construction.
- Puy de Dôme: As the highest volcano in the Chaîne des Puys, Puy de Dôme offers breathtaking views of the Auvergne region. Take a scenic train ride or hike to the summit to enjoy panoramic vistas, visit the Temple of Mercury, and learn about the site's historical significance.
- Michelin Adventure Museum: Located in Clermont-Ferrand, the Michelin Adventure Museum presents the history and innovation behind the famous Michelin tire brand. Discover vintage cars, interactive displays, and learn about the company's impact on the automotive industry.
- Maison de la Pierre: Situated in Volvic, the Maison de la Pierre is dedicated to the region's volcanic stone industry. Explore the exhibition showcasing the extraction and use of the stone, learn about its importance in local architecture, and discover the unique qualities of Volvic stone.
- Château de Malauzat: A short distance from Combronde, Château de Malauzat is an elegant 19th-century castle surrounded by a vast park. Enjoy a leisurely stroll through the landscaped gardens, admire the architecture, and learn about the castle's history.
- Église Saint-Pierre: Located in Mozac, the Église Saint-Pierre is an impressive Romanesque church dating back to the 12th century.
